Dave Matthews Band opened up their 2018 touring schedule in Texas last night with a show at The Cynthia Woods Mitchell Pavilion in The Woodlands. The show, which came after former DMB violinist Boyd Tinsley was accused of sexual misconduct toward a protege earlier this week, marked the debut for new DMB keyboardist Buddy Strong, who announced earlier this year he will be joining the band for the full tour. The night also featured two songs from the group’s upcoming album Come Tomorrow and a few tunes that hadn’t been in the DMB rotation for several years.

Matthews and company kicked off the evening with the title track from the new album, playing the song live for the first time. The lyrics speak a bit to the current social climate in the country, with Matthews offering, “As far as I can see/ We should let the children lead.”

After the opener, the group launched into the first “Louisiana Bayou” since July 2015, just one of last night’s bustouts. Along with DMB favorites like “What Would You Say,” “#41,” “Satellite,” “Rapunzel” and “Crush,” plus the staple “Samurai Cop (Oh Joy Begin),” which also appears on Come Tomorrow, the band dusted off “#27” for the first time since July 2014, “What You Are” for the first time since May 2013 and “Stand Up (For It)” for the first time since October 2007, a span of 796 shows.

Matthews also led his bandmates through the first full-band rendition of “Do You Remember,” the third and final new album track played last night. The night would later end with a two-song encore of “You & Me” and “Grey Street.”

Dave Matthews Band
The Cynthia Woods Mitchell Pavilion The Woodlands, TX

Buddy Strong makes his DMB debut on keyboards

Come Tomorrow*, Louisiana Bayou, One Sweet World, What Would You Say, #41, Seven, Recently, Satellite, Lying In the Hands of God, Samurai Cop, Don’t Drink the Water, Typical Situation, Pantala Naga Pampa, Rapunzel, #27, Do You Remember^, Crush, What You Are, Stand Up (For It)

Enc: You and Me, Grey Street

Notes:
*Debut
^First time played by DMB (previously perfomed by Dave and Tim and Dave solo)
